Windows Service o IIS ?

sabato 05 settembre 2009 - 11.45

gipasoft Profilo | Newbie

Un po' di tempo fa ho dovuto trasformare una applicazione desktop in distribuita.
Era da poco uscito WCF e pensai di usarlo al posto dei tradizionali web service, dopo le prime prove decisi, per rendere più semplice l'avvio dello sviluppo, di usare un window service e non IIS.

Ora iniziano ad esserci più utenti che accedono ai servizi, mi viene il dubbio che, utilizzare un window service, rispetto a IIS, per ospitare la parte server della mia applicazione possa avere delle controindicazioni.... cosa ne pensate?

Alcuni giorni fa ho rilevato il seguente errore: "Transaction (Process ID 57) was deadlocked on lock resources with another process and has been chosen as the deadlock victim" ... non penso dipenda dalla mia scelta di usare un window service.... ma è servito a farmi nascere il dubbio :-)

alx_81 Profilo | Guru

Ciao
>Alcuni giorni fa ho rilevato il seguente errore: "Transaction
>(Process ID 57) was deadlocked on lock resources with another
>process and has been chosen as the deadlock victim" ... non penso
>dipenda dalla mia scelta di usare un window service.... ma è
>servito a farmi nascere il dubbio :-)

No, quello è un deadlock di sql. Leggi qui per maggiori info:
http://www.sql-server-performance.com/tips/deadlocks_p1.aspx
http://msdn.microsoft.com/it-it/library/ms188246.aspx
--

Alessandro Alpi | SQL Server MVP

http://www.alessandroalpi.net
http://blogs.dotnethell.it/suxstellino
http://mvp.support.microsoft.com/profile/Alessandro.Alpi
http://italy.mvps.org
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2025
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5